Foros del Web » Programando para Internet » Javascript »

Un desafio.............

Estas en el tema de Un desafio............. en el foro de Javascript en Foros del Web. Que tal............. tengo un foro de melodysoft, en el cual me permite agregar emoticones en los mensajes........ los emoticones los cargo en melodysoft, y luego ...
  #1 (permalink)  
Antiguo 12/12/2003, 22:35
 
Fecha de Ingreso: octubre-2003
Mensajes: 11
Antigüedad: 20 años, 6 meses
Puntos: 0
Un desafio.............

Que tal............. tengo un foro de melodysoft, en el cual me permite agregar emoticones en los mensajes........ los emoticones los cargo en melodysoft, y luego expongo en una web el emoticon con el codigocorres pondiente..... ejemplo: =+sonrisa+ ( el codigo va entre los mas) y el codigo hay que insertarlo a mano.

El problema, es que vi esto..... que desde mi foro podria abrir una nueva ventana, en la cual mostrara solo los emoticones, y al presionarlos, se insertarian directamente en el mensaje..... !!!! esto seria maravilloso!!


Consegui este script, pero no logro que funcione



<SCRIPT lang="Javascript" type="text/javascript">function add_smilie(a_smilie){if(opener.location.document.m ensaje!=window.undef){opener.location.document.men saje.message.value+=" "+a_smilie+" ";window.opener.document.mensaje.message.focus();w indow.close();};};function wc(ty, sp, w, h, pic){document.write('<tr align="center"><td bgcolor="#DDDDDD"><a href="javascript:add_smilie(\''+ty+'\')"><B>'+ty+' </B></a></td><TD bgcolor="#FFFFFF"></TD><td bgcolor="#DDDDDD">'+sp+'<a href="javascript:add_smilie(\''+ty+'\')"><img src="http://www.hepatitisc2000.com.ar/imagenes/Emoticones/NUEVOS/'+pic+'.gif" width="'+w+'" height="'+h+'" border=0></a></td></tr>');};function cwc(ty, sp, pic){document.write('<tr align="center"><td bgcolor="#DDDDDD"><a href="javascript:add_smilie(\''+ty+'\')" class="nounder"><B>'+ty+'</B></a></td><TD bgcolor="#FFFFFF"></TD><td bgcolor="#DDDDDD">'+sp+'<a href="javascript:add_smilie(\''+ty+'\')"><img src="'+pic+'" border=0></a></td></tr>');};
</SCRIPT>
</HEAD>
<body bgcolor="#FFFFFF" text="#000000" link="#000000" vlink="#000000" leftmargin="0" topmargin="0" marginwidth="0" marginheight="0">
<table width="0%" border="0" RULES=NONE cellspacing="1" cellpadding="2">
<tr bgcolor="#a4acb8" valign="center" align="center">
<td nowrap><p><font size="2" face="Verdana"><b>Codigos de los</b><BR>
<b>Emoticones</b></font></td>
<TD bgcolor="#FFFFFF">
</TD>
<td nowrap><b><font size="2" face="Verdana">El</font></b><font size="2" face="Verdana"><BR>
<b>Emoticon</b></font></td>
</tr>
<SCRIPT>wc("+navega+","",44,'+45+',"navegando");wc ("+saluda+","",25,'+15+',"adios");</SCRIPT>




El ID, de mi textarea es: "mensaje"
Desde ya, les gradezco cualquier respuesta
Matias
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:37.